Explanation

Auscultation of the lung is a medical term that refers to the process of listening to the sounds made by the lungs. This is usually done using a tool called a stethoscope, which doctors place on the patient's back and chest. By doing this, doctors can check for any abnormalities or issues with the lungs, such as fluid buildup or problems with airflow. This is a common method used to help diagnose lung conditions.
